Hospital La Inmaculada de Huércal-Overa is one of the most modern hospitals in the Andalusian region of Spain, with 205 beds serving 135,000 people in northern Almería. The hospital’s laboratory has seen its testing volume increase by 20 percent over the last two years, and the staff expects the growth to continue. Annually, the lab had performed three very different types of specialty testing in two separate departments: 25,000 infectious disease tests, 1,500 maternal screenings, and 3,000 allergy tests. To manage the laboratory’s growth, the staff decided in 2010 to consolidate the three disciplines into a single automated system that one technologist could easily operate. "It’s difficult to increase staff to handle the growth we’re experiencing," says Jiménez. "We had to find a system that could do more work with the same people or even fewer." The VersaCell™ system has allowed the lab to consolidate specialty testing into a single platform, optimize resource utilization, and ultimately, unite their lab.
